Finance Review Summary — Hedging Decision

For the incoming director. In March, Brindlewood Textiles moved from a rolling 30% hedge to a layered 70% program on its torren exposure, following two quarters of adverse movement. Costs rose modestly; earnings volatility dropped as modeled. The committee reviews ratios quarterly, next session in June. Treasury holds the full instrument schedule. The decision connects directly to the strategy outlined below.

management briefing: Project Ulavan slips by two quarters because of the staffing delay.

Management Meeting Minutes — Warranty Cost Overrun

Attendees: department heads; chaired by R. Falwick.

The meeting reviewed the warranty overrun on the Cindermere pump line, now 38% above budget for the half. Root cause traced to a seal supplier change made in spring; failure rates tripled in humid markets. Actions agreed: revert to the prior seal spec immediately, extend affected customers' coverage by six months, and have quality audit the Dellway plant. Finance will restate the reserve. The related plan is recorded below.

management briefing: Istaelix Group is in early talks to buy Sorysax Logistics for about $496.2 million. The Kasox launch date is October 3, and nothing goes to the press before then. Legal wants the Norokax Foods term sheet withdrawn before April 25.

Runbook: GarageGlance occupancy feed

If the Harborview Deck occupancy feed goes stale (no updates for 5+ minutes), first check the sensor gateway health page. Green but stale usually means the aggregator queue is backed up; restart the aggregator via the ops console and counts should recover within two minutes. If spots show negative numbers, force a full recount from the camera snapshots. When escalating to engineering, include the trace token shown below.

session token of yawif-kahof = htk9_dd6996ed6

**Step 7 — ParcelPing webhook signing key.** Rotate the HMAC secret for the Lorvex parcel-tracking webhook before sealing. Confirm delivery callbacks from the Trenholt depot sandbox return 200. New contractors: do not skip the dry-run; Drexa Logistics requires two witnesses present. Once both witnesses sign the ledger, the vault custodian reads out the recovery material. Record it exactly as spoken. The recovery passphrase for this key follows below.

unlock words, kajef-kadug: sorys-pelax-lamael-tamvan-briiel-novdor-fenwyn-tamdor-oliion-keleth-julok-belion-ralok